Chiefs vs Saints PPH Preview for Monday Night Football Week 5

Week 5 of the NFL season is going to kickoff on Thursday night, and the action will go all the way into Monday. There is just one game this weekend on Monday Night Football, and it’s going to be a matchup between the New Orleans Saints and the Kansas City Chiefs. 

This is going to be one of the better games of the weekend, but the Chiefs are listed as 5.5 point betting favorites in this game. The over/under is set at 43.5 total points, and those are two numbers that you should be focusing on.

Saints Must Score

The New Orleans Saints began the season by scoring at least 44 points in two straight games, but the offense has struggled since that time. New Orleans wants to be a team that is great on offense, but they just haven’t had a ton of success in the last two games. 

Quarterback Kirk Cousins has plenty of weapons at his disposal, but the offensive line is going to have to give him some time to operate in this one. New Orleans continues to be a team that is searching for defense, and that will come into play in this game as well. 

Chiefs Dealing With Injuries

The Kansas City Chiefs continue to be dealt some difficult blows in the injury department, and that is something to monitor. Rashee Rice is going to miss this game with a knee injury, and the Chiefs have struggled to put points on the board already.

Quarterback Patrick Mahomes has continued to play efficient football this season, and the defense has been shutting down some great offenses all season long. The Chiefs simply know how to win football games, and they have a number of ways to attack opponents. 

No Stopping KC

The Kansas City Chiefs have not looked dominant this season, but they are still one of the teams with a perfect record through four games. Kansas City just always seems to find a way to win, and they continue to be nearly unstoppable when playing at home. 

This Saints team is going to be fighting for a playoff spot all season long, but they still have some problems that are going to get exposed in this game. Kansas City should win this game by more than a touchdown and there will be at least 44 points scored in this one.
